Gentoo Archives: gentoo-commits

From: Amy Winston <amynka@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-misc/grabcartoons/
Date: Fri, 24 Jun 2016 14:09:31
Message-Id: 1466777265.f1436323af733e30ca819cfe93b39fdb3f95330b.amynka@gentoo
1 commit: f1436323af733e30ca819cfe93b39fdb3f95330b
2 Author: Amy Winston <amynka <AT> gentoo <DOT> org>
3 AuthorDate: Fri Jun 24 14:04:57 2016 +0000
4 Commit: Amy Winston <amynka <AT> gentoo <DOT> org>
5 CommitDate: Fri Jun 24 14:07:45 2016 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f1436323
7
8 app-misc/grabcartoons: remove git-r3 eclass, eapi bump
9
10 Package-Manager: portage-2.2.28
11
12 app-misc/grabcartoons/Manifest | 1 +
13 .../grabcartoons-2.8.4_p20141112.ebuild | 29 +++++++++-------------
14 2 files changed, 13 insertions(+), 17 deletions(-)
15
16 diff --git a/app-misc/grabcartoons/Manifest b/app-misc/grabcartoons/Manifest
17 new file mode 100644
18 index 0000000..0c0b901
19 --- /dev/null
20 +++ b/app-misc/grabcartoons/Manifest
21 @@ -0,0 +1 @@
22 +DIST cb230f01fb288a0b9f0fc437545b97d06c846bd3.tar.gz 40998 SHA256 4cb1061ff66540d8b9fe5ef470cdf55ba3e458fd136d59250a626eb4f29d519c SHA512 6de81d151414ccbb7b00c2f472f0d811a7024c67a3c4bdc929babf2ff8990280ba1fde0851e4405dbc487c58e99f13a1dd07a0cd202099f6289dd0ed61296ee5 WHIRLPOOL b52c5e1b786dc2073f70c46e1a7a16d89ef586aa42456466466c5bff9e39f27a74c471c41a5682950563f1f7ff93669b8bd285d3642d66ed46a593c3f96e6a59
23
24 diff --git a/app-misc/grabcartoons/grabcartoons-2.8.4_p20141112.ebuild b/app-misc/grabcartoons/grabcartoons-2.8.4_p20141112.ebuild
25 index 370741d..f0dde21 100644
26 --- a/app-misc/grabcartoons/grabcartoons-2.8.4_p20141112.ebuild
27 +++ b/app-misc/grabcartoons/grabcartoons-2.8.4_p20141112.ebuild
28 @@ -1,35 +1,30 @@
29 -# Copyright 1999-2015 Gentoo Foundation
30 +# Copyright 1999-2016 Gentoo Foundation
31 # Distributed under the terms of the GNU General Public License v2
32 # $Id$
33
34 -EAPI=5
35 -
36 -inherit eutils git-r3
37 +EAPI=6
38
39 DESCRIPTION="Comic-summarizing utility"
40 HOMEPAGE="http://zzamboni.org/grabcartoons"
41 -
42 -EGIT_REPO_URI="https://github.com/zzamboni/grabcartoons.git"
43 -
44 -if [[ "${PV}" != "9999" ]] ; then
45 - KEYWORDS="~amd64 ~x86"
46 - EGIT_COMMIT="cb230f01fb288a0b9f0fc437545b97d06c846bd3"
47 -fi
48 -
49 +EGIT_COMMIT="cb230f01fb288a0b9f0fc437545b97d06c846bd3"
50 +SRC_URI="https://github.com/zzamboni/grabcartoons/archive/cb230f01fb288a0b9f0fc437545b97d06c846bd3.tar.gz"
51 +KEYWORDS="~amd64 ~x86"
52 LICENSE="BSD"
53 SLOT="0"
54
55 -RDEPEND="dev-lang/perl
56 +RDEPEND="
57 + dev-lang/perl
58 virtual/perl-Getopt-Long"
59
60 # Opens a web page, which is unacceptable during an emerge.
61 RESTRICT="test"
62 +S="${WORKDIR}/${PN}-${EGIT_COMMIT}"
63
64 -src_prepare() {
65 - epatch "${FILESDIR}"/2.8.4-fix-install-paths.patch
66 -}
67 +PATCHES=(
68 + "${FILESDIR}"/2.8.4-fix-install-paths.patch
69 + )
70
71 src_install() {
72 - emake PREFIX="${ED}"/usr install
73 + emake PREFIX="${ED}"usr install
74 dodoc ChangeLog README
75 }